Sustainable practices in cotton waste management


Cotton, a versatile and widely-used natural fiber, is an integral part of the global textile industry. However, the production and usage of cotton generate a significant amount of waste that poses environmental challenges. The textile industry faces the pressing need to adopt sustainable practices in cotton waste management to minimize its ecological footprint and ensure a greener future. This article explores various approaches and strategies employed by industry players to tackle the issue of cotton waste effectively.


Understanding the cotton waste problem


Cotton waste comprises various forms, such as lint waste, yarn waste, and fabric waste. The textile industry produces immense volumes of cotton waste through processes like spinning, weaving, and garment production. Additionally, waste is generated at each stage of the cotton supply chain, from farming to manufacturing and consumer use. The cumulative impact of this waste is alarming, with adverse ramifications for the environment.


The disposal of cotton waste presents a significant challenge for the textile industry. Landfills and incineration are traditional waste disposal methods, but they contribute to pollution and strain natural resources. Therefore, sustainable alternatives are essential to reduce the environmental impact associated with cotton waste.


The potential of recycling cotton waste


Recycling plays a vital role in sustainable cotton waste management. The process involves turning waste fibers into new products or raw materials, reducing the need for virgin resources. Recycling cotton waste offers several benefits, including waste diversion from landfills, energy conservation, and minimizing water consumption. Furthermore, recycling promotes the development of a circular economy, which aims to eliminate waste and maximize resource efficiency.


In recent years, several technological advancements have enabled the textile industry to improve the recycling of cotton waste. Mechanical recycling involves shredding and processing cotton waste to create new fibers for use in various applications. Chemical recycling, on the other hand, focuses on breaking down cotton waste into its chemical components to produce regenerated fibers. Both approaches have shown promising results in terms of waste reduction and resource conservation.


Efficient waste management through waste hierarchy


To effectively manage cotton waste in a sustainable manner, the waste hierarchy provides a helpful framework. This hierarchy prioritizes waste management strategies based on their environmental impact, with an emphasis on waste reduction and resource recovery. By following this hierarchy, the textile industry can minimize waste generation and maximize its potential for recycling.


The first and most important step in the waste hierarchy is waste prevention. This step involves taking measures to reduce waste at its source, such as improving production processes and developing more efficient fiber utilization methods. By addressing the root causes of waste generation, the textile industry can significantly decrease its environmental footprint.


Waste reduction through product design


Product design also plays a critical role in cotton waste management. Designers can incorporate principles of waste reduction by creating garments that minimize fabric waste during production. Implementing modular design concepts allows for easy repair and replacement of worn-out parts, extending the lifespan of garments and reducing the overall waste generated by the textile industry.


Implementing efficient waste segregation


Efficient waste segregation is crucial for effective cotton waste management. By separating different types of waste at the source, such as lint waste, yarn waste, and fabric waste, the recycling process becomes more efficient and cost-effective. This segregation allows for better utilization of each waste stream, ensuring that specific recycling methods are employed to extract maximum value from the waste.


Collaboration across the supply chain


To achieve sustainable cotton waste management, collaboration across the textile supply chain is essential. From cotton farmers to manufacturers and retailers, all stakeholders must work together to establish comprehensive waste management practices. Collaboration can take various forms, such as sharing best practices, promoting research and development, and creating industry-wide initiatives to encourage sustainable practices in cotton waste management.
